What is Cross-Play Compatibility Test Matrix?

The Cross-Play Compatibility Test Matrix is a structured framework designed to evaluate and ensure seamless interaction between players across different gaming platforms. With the rise of cross-platform gaming, ensuring compatibility between devices such as consoles, PCs, and mobile platforms has become a critical task for developers. This matrix provides a comprehensive approach to testing, covering aspects like network synchronization, input compatibility, and graphical fidelity. By using this matrix, developers can identify potential issues early in the development cycle, ensuring a smooth gaming experience for users. For instance, a game that supports cross-play between Xbox and PlayStation must undergo rigorous testing to ensure that players on both platforms can interact without any technical glitches.

Why use this Cross-Play Compatibility Test Matrix?

Cross-platform gaming introduces unique challenges, such as varying hardware capabilities, network protocols, and input methods. The Cross-Play Compatibility Test Matrix addresses these challenges by providing a structured approach to testing. For instance, it helps identify issues like input lag on one platform or graphical inconsistencies between devices. By using this matrix, teams can ensure that their game delivers a seamless experience, regardless of the platform. This is particularly important in competitive gaming scenarios, where even minor discrepancies can impact gameplay. Additionally, the matrix helps streamline the testing process, saving time and resources while ensuring high-quality outcomes.
